Yester and Kollar Named Caterpillar Scholar Athletes
5/17/2004 12:00:00 AM | Pack Athletics
May 15, 2004
Caterpillar is proud to partner with NC State to present a program that honors the achievements of our student-athletes in the classrooms as well as on the playing fields. Each month two Wolfpack Scholar athletes will be selected as a member of the Caterpillar Scholar Athlete team. To be named to the Caterpillar Scholar Athlete team, a student-athlete must maintain a 3.00 GPA for at least one semester and be a full-time student at NC State.
During the Fall 2003 semester 236 Wolfpack Student Athletes achieved a semester GPA of 3.00 or higher and 118 student-athletes were Dean's List honorees.
This month Caterpillar and NC State are proud to honor track and field's Jessie Yester and Chris Kollar.
Jessie Yester |
Jessie Yester is a long distance runner for the NC State Women's Track team. The freshman is a native of Downington, Pennsylvania. Jessie has gone the distance in the classroom with a 3.78 Total Grade Point Average. Among the Chemistry major's other accomplishments are having been named to the NC State Dean's List during the fall semester of 2003.
Chris Kollar |
Chris Kollar is a freshman on the NC State Men's Track team. The Biological Sciences major makes his mark in the distance events. Chris also has does it in the classroom, sporting a 3.62 Total Grade Point Average. The native of Strongsville, Ohio, was also named to the NC State Dean's List during the fall semester of 2003.
